Transaction 267816445ab712881a61ee5b961fc9b3441e6965dcdc16a392d36c979222717b
1 Input
1 Output
-
267816445ab712881a61ee5b961fc9b3441e6965dcdc16a392d36c979222717b:0
- value
- 673413
- script pubkey
- OP_0 OP_PUSHBYTES_20 f889d5e6a997dccf768a74fa75b0d63bc49cf103
- address
- bc1qlzyate4fjlwv7a52wna8tvxk80zfeugrmtymnx